Don't confuce MICs (barracks) with government types. You'll need either government type III or IV if you want to build a regional MIC level 4. Relating to recruitment, the government types only restrict the MIC levels available.
Goes something like this I believe:
Government - - - Factional MIC - - - Regional MIC
Type I - - - - - - Level 5 - - - - - - - Level 2
Type II - - - - - - Level 4 - - - - - - - Level 3
Type III - - - - - - Level 3 - - - - - - - Level 4
Type IV - - - - - - Level 2 - - - - - - - Level 5
